Lethal Performance is proud to offer everyone in the GT500 community the opportunity to get the Fore Precision Works GT500 hood vents at a special introductory group buy price.

The Fore Precision Works Hood Vents were a huge success in the Terminator community and you can expect nothing less than perfect on their GT500 version. The hood vents are CNC machined from high quality aluminum and anodized for a long lasting protective finish. The billet hood vents are direct replacement for your stock GT500 vents. No more wax build up or crappy looking faded plastic on your hood. The quality of these vents will amaze you once you see them in person.

The deal is this:

We need 20 people to commit to the vents in order to get them into production. Once we have the 20 sets sold it will take 8-10 weeks for them to be ready to ship. The good news is that we've already got 5 sets sold so there's only 15 more people that we need to make this happen.

The vents are going to be available in Black or Clear anodized finishes. Retail Pricing on the vents is $300.00


The remaining 15 people that we get on board will receive a 10% discount which will bring the price down to $270.00 and as an added bonus we're going to ship them for FREE!!

All you need to do to get in on the group buy is reply to this thread with your name and the color vent you want and we'll keep the GB open until the remaining 15 people have committed.
